44/* read 512 bytes from endpoint 0x86 -> get header + blobs */
45struct sur40_header {
46
47	__le16 type;       /* always 0x0001 */
48	__le16 count;      /* count of blobs (if 0: continue prev. packet) */
49
50	__le32 packet_id;  /* unique ID for all packets in one frame */
51
52	__le32 timestamp;  /* milliseconds (inc. by 16 or 17 each frame) */
53	__le32 unknown;    /* "epoch?" always 02/03 00 00 00 */
54
55} __packed;
56
57struct sur40_blob {
58
59	__le16 blob_id;
60
61	u8 action;         /* 0x02 = enter/exit, 0x03 = update (?) */
62	u8 unknown;        /* always 0x01 or 0x02 (no idea what this is?) */
63
64	__le16 bb_pos_x;   /* upper left corner of bounding box */
65	__le16 bb_pos_y;
66
67	__le16 bb_size_x;  /* size of bounding box */
68	__le16 bb_size_y;
69
70	__le16 pos_x;      /* finger tip position */
71	__le16 pos_y;
72
73	__le16 ctr_x;      /* centroid position */
74	__le16 ctr_y;
75
76	__le16 axis_x;     /* somehow related to major/minor axis, mostly: */
77	__le16 axis_y;     /* axis_x == bb_size_y && axis_y == bb_size_x */
78
79	__le32 angle;      /* orientation in radians relative to x axis -
80	                      actually an IEEE754 float, don't use in kernel */
81
82	__le32 area;       /* size in pixels/pressure (?) */
83
84	u8 padding[32];
85
86} __packed;
87
88/* combined header/blob data */
89struct sur40_data {
90	struct sur40_header header;
91	struct sur40_blob   blobs[];
92} __packed;
93
94/* read 512 bytes from endpoint 0x82 -> get header below
95 * continue reading 16k blocks until header.size bytes read */
96struct sur40_image_header {
97	__le32 magic;     /* "SUBF" */
98	__le32 packet_id;
99	__le32 size;      /* always 0x0007e900 = 960x540 */
100	__le32 timestamp; /* milliseconds (increases by 16 or 17 each frame) */
101	__le32 unknown;   /* "epoch?" always 02/03 00 00 00 */
102} __packed;

177/*
178 * Note: an earlier, non-public version of this driver used USB_RECIP_ENDPOINT
179 * here by mistake which is very likely to have corrupted the firmware EEPROM
180 * on two separate SUR40 devices. Thanks to Alan Stern who spotted this bug.
181 * Should you ever run into a similar problem, the background story to this
182 * incident and instructions on how to fix the corrupted EEPROM are available
183 * at https://floe.butterbrot.org/matrix/hacking/surface/brick.html
184*/
185
186/* command wrapper */
187static int sur40_command(struct sur40_state *dev,
188			 u8 command, u16 index, void *buffer, u16 size)
189{
190	return usb_control_msg(dev->usbdev, usb_rcvctrlpipe(dev->usbdev, 0),
191			       command,
192			       USB_TYPE_VENDOR | USB_RECIP_DEVICE | USB_DIR_IN,
193			       0x00, index, buffer, size, 1000);
194}
195
196/* Initialization routine, called from sur40_open */
197static int sur40_init(struct sur40_state *dev)
198{
199	int result;
200	u8 buffer[24];
201
202	/* stupidly replay the original MS driver init sequence */
203	result = sur40_command(dev, SUR40_GET_VERSION, 0x00, buffer, 12);
204	if (result < 0)
205		return result;
206
207	result = sur40_command(dev, SUR40_GET_VERSION, 0x01, buffer, 12);
208	if (result < 0)
209		return result;
210
211	result = sur40_command(dev, SUR40_GET_VERSION, 0x02, buffer, 12);
212	if (result < 0)
213		return result;
214
215	result = sur40_command(dev, SUR40_UNKNOWN2,    0x00, buffer, 24);
216	if (result < 0)
217		return result;
218
219	result = sur40_command(dev, SUR40_UNKNOWN1,    0x00, buffer,  5);
220	if (result < 0)
221		return result;
222
223	result = sur40_command(dev, SUR40_GET_VERSION, 0x03, buffer, 12);
224
225	/*
226	 * Discard the result buffer - no known data inside except
227	 * some version strings, maybe extract these sometime...
228	 */
229
230	return result;
231}

258/*
259 * This function is called when a whole contact has been processed,
260 * so that it can assign it to a slot and store the data there.
261 */
262static void sur40_report_blob(struct sur40_blob *blob, struct input_dev *input)
263{
264	int wide, major, minor;
265
266	int bb_size_x = le16_to_cpu(blob->bb_size_x);
267	int bb_size_y = le16_to_cpu(blob->bb_size_y);
268
269	int pos_x = le16_to_cpu(blob->pos_x);
270	int pos_y = le16_to_cpu(blob->pos_y);
271
272	int ctr_x = le16_to_cpu(blob->ctr_x);
273	int ctr_y = le16_to_cpu(blob->ctr_y);
274
275	int slotnum = input_mt_get_slot_by_key(input, blob->blob_id);
276	if (slotnum < 0 || slotnum >= MAX_CONTACTS)
277		return;
278
279	input_mt_slot(input, slotnum);
280	input_mt_report_slot_state(input, MT_TOOL_FINGER, 1);
281	wide = (bb_size_x > bb_size_y);
282	major = max(bb_size_x, bb_size_y);
283	minor = min(bb_size_x, bb_size_y);
284
285	input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_POSITION_X, pos_x);
286	input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_POSITION_Y, pos_y);
287	input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_TOOL_X, ctr_x);
288	input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_TOOL_Y, ctr_y);
289
290	/* TODO: use a better orientation measure */
291	input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_ORIENTATION, wide);
292	input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_TOUCH_MAJOR, major);
293	input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_TOUCH_MINOR, minor);
294}
295
296/* core function: poll for new input data */
297static void sur40_poll(struct input_polled_dev *polldev)
298{
299	struct sur40_state *sur40 = polldev->private;
300	struct input_dev *input = polldev->input;
301	int result, bulk_read, need_blobs, packet_blobs, i;
302	u32 uninitialized_var(packet_id);
303
304	struct sur40_header *header = &sur40->bulk_in_buffer->header;
305	struct sur40_blob *inblob = &sur40->bulk_in_buffer->blobs[0];
306
307	dev_dbg(sur40->dev, "poll\n");
308
309	need_blobs = -1;
310
311	do {
312
313		/* perform a blocking bulk read to get data from the device */
314		result = usb_bulk_msg(sur40->usbdev,
315			usb_rcvbulkpipe(sur40->usbdev, sur40->bulk_in_epaddr),
316			sur40->bulk_in_buffer, sur40->bulk_in_size,
317			&bulk_read, 1000);
318
319		dev_dbg(sur40->dev, "received %d bytes\n", bulk_read);
320
321		if (result < 0) {
322			dev_err(sur40->dev, "error in usb_bulk_read\n");
323			return;
324		}
325
326		result = bulk_read - sizeof(struct sur40_header);
327
328		if (result % sizeof(struct sur40_blob) != 0) {
329			dev_err(sur40->dev, "transfer size mismatch\n");
330			return;
331		}
332
333		/* first packet? */
334		if (need_blobs == -1) {
335			need_blobs = le16_to_cpu(header->count);
336			dev_dbg(sur40->dev, "need %d blobs\n", need_blobs);
337			packet_id = le32_to_cpu(header->packet_id);
338		}
339
340		/*
341		 * Sanity check. when video data is also being retrieved, the
342		 * packet ID will usually increase in the middle of a series
343		 * instead of at the end.
344		 */
345		if (packet_id != header->packet_id)
346			dev_dbg(sur40->dev, "packet ID mismatch\n");
347
348		packet_blobs = result / sizeof(struct sur40_blob);
349		dev_dbg(sur40->dev, "received %d blobs\n", packet_blobs);
350
351		/* packets always contain at least 4 blobs, even if empty */
352		if (packet_blobs > need_blobs)
353			packet_blobs = need_blobs;
354
355		for (i = 0; i < packet_blobs; i++) {
356			need_blobs--;
357			dev_dbg(sur40->dev, "processing blob\n");
358			sur40_report_blob(&(inblob[i]), input);
359		}
360
361	} while (need_blobs > 0);
362
363	input_mt_sync_frame(input);
364	input_sync(input);
365
366	sur40_process_video(sur40);
367}
